Intentional or unintentional, do you really want to make that distinction? If the ASA wants the ump to make every call on a runner hit by a batted ball based on the intent, they are asking us to take on an argument we don't need. 99 out of 100 times if a runner is hit by a fair batted ball and not in contact with a base, while a fielder has a chance to make a play, the runner will be called out.
